The advanced work in Nei Dan (Daoist internal alchemy) begins with the cultivation and transformation of generative energy, or jing.
With Eva Wong, 19th generation lineage carrier of Nei Dan Pai Xiantianwujimen Daoism The advanced work in Nei Dan Pai (Daoist internal alchemy) begins with the cultivation and transformation of generative energy, or jing. In this 7-day retreat, we will accomplish the following stages of inner alchemical work: Establish the 3 realms of jing, qi, and shen in the internal universe Nourish and strengthen the various regions of the water realm: bubbling springs sea of qi the storehouse of jing (kidneys) the lower dantien and the well of jing (tailbone) Transform post-celestial jing into pre-celestial jing Return the jing to the top of the head The Tiger Dragon Practice of the copulation of fire and water Circulate generative energy in the Microcosmic Orbit Strengthen and seal the storehouses of jing. The Qigong of Xiantianwujimen Taoism Xiantianwujimen is a Daoist lineage founded by Chen Xiyi in 10th century China. “Xiantian” means primordial, “wuji” means limitless, and “men” means gate. The translated name of the lineage is Primordial Limitless Gate. This lineage specializes in using qigong to simultaneously cultivate and transform body and mind. A hermit and household tradition, Xiantianwujimen has been transmitted uninterrupted for over a thousand years. Qigong techniques favored by this lineage include self-massage, tendon changing, calisthenics, marrow washing, and breath regulation. Instruction of Xiantianwujimen qigong is offered by Eva Wong, a 19th generation carrier of the lineage, and by instructors authorized by the lineage.
